About Good Heavens!

Xant-Rar, a realm meant for peace and enjoyment, needs external help to restore order due to..slight oversights by its deity, the Mighty Rar. As the “Latest Chosen One”, you are the hero tasked with fixing what the Mighty Rar neglected to address or refine.

Procedural World Generation & Adaptive Narrative

Xant-Rar is a realm that houses environments that are constantly shifting and a dynamic narrative based on the player’s choices. Players must navigate floating islands and interact with... diverse shall we say, inhabitants to fulfill their heroic role.

Tree-based progression with a dynamic class system

Players can choose from 6 different tech trees and a flexible class system that allows customization of abilities to suit various playstyles. Options are available for those who prefer crafting, exploration, trade, or a versatile approach, so any difficulties you may encounter with the inhabitants of Xant-Rar can be chalked up as “skill issues”.

Online Co-op and Base Building

Good Heavens! is intended to played by up to 4 players but players can team up with as many players as they want in cooperative online gameplay to build a base on Xant-Rar and go about fixing Rar’s mishaps. 

Players can solve quests, raise cities from rubble quite literally, and show the inhabitants of Xant-Rar how it's done...again. (Sorry).

What’s inside this demo?

  •  One procedurally generated island

  •  A single biome with 4 distinct sub-biomes

  • One boss fight and lots of monster camps / dungeons

  • Two cities with random cultures

  •  Around 2+ hours of gameplay (longer if you get distracted, which we guarantee you will)

System Requirements

    Minimum:
    •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
    • OS: Windows 10
    • Processor: i5 6700
    • Memory: 4 GB RAM
    • Graphics: GTX 1650
    • DirectX: Version 11
    • Storage: 2 GB available space
    Recommended:
    •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
    • OS: Windows 10+
    • Processor: i7 6700
    • Memory: 8 GB RAM
    • Graphics: GTX 1070
    • DirectX: Version 11
    • Storage: 4 GB available space
